Job description

We’re looking for a Test Automation Engineer to help build and enhance automated testing capability across complex distributed systems. This role goes far beyond writing automated tests. You’ll develop frameworks, tooling and infrastructure that validate software operating across cloud services, networks, hardware and real-world environments. Working closely with engineers, you’ll help ensure systems are reliable, resilient, secure and ready for production., * Building automated test frameworks across cloud, networking and hardware platforms

  • Creating end-to-end testing environments using hardware and simulation technologies
  • Designing resilience, fault-injection and chaos-testing scenarios
  • Testing backend services, networking functionality and platform reliability
  • Supporting API, UI, integration and performance testing across React and Go applications
  • Developing automated testing for real-time and event-driven features
  • Integrating testing into CI/CD pipelines
  • Improving test reliability and reducing flaky test behaviour
  • Converting identified defects into automated regression coverage

Requirements

Essential Skills

  • Software engineering experience using Go, Rust or C, combined with Python or Shell scripting
  • Experience building automated test frameworks, harnesses and testing infrastructure
  • Understanding of distributed systems, asynchronous workflows and eventual consistency
  • Experience with Go Testing, Playwright, Jest or similar frameworks
  • CI/CD experience, ideally GitHub Actions
  • Docker and containerised test environments
  • Strong networking knowledge including TCP/IP, UDP, DNS, NAT, routing and tunnelling Technical Knowledge

  • Go testing and table-driven tests
  • React component and end-to-end testing
  • Performance and load testing
  • Security testing including mTLS and certificate authentication
  • SQL and database testing
  • Server-Sent Events (SSE)
  • Mock services, fixtures and test environments
  • Fuzz, differential and property-based testing Desirable Experience

  • Rust testing frameworks
  • Chaos engineering
  • OpenWRT or embedded Linux
  • Hardware-in-the-loop testing
  • QEMU
  • Cellular networking platforms
  • Terraform testing
  • Large-scale distributed environments
